执行剧本

如何利用Pigsty提供的剧本完成完整的初始化。

Pigsty采用声明式接口,配置完成之后只需运行固定的 剧本(Playbook),即可完成部署

基本部署

  • 基础设施部署:在元节点上部署Pigsty所需的基础设施infra.yml

  • PG集群部署:在普通节点上部署高可用PostgreSQL数据库集群:pgsql.yml

沙箱部署

针对本地沙箱环境,Pigsty提供了特殊的快速一键部署剧本 sandbox.yml

该剧本采用交织式部署,可以同时完成基础设施与PG集群的部署任务,让沙箱的拉起速度加倍。

仅监控部署

Pigsty提供仅监控部署剧本:pgsql-monitor.yml,用于集成已有供给方案,监控现有数据库集群

日常管理

Pigsty还提供了一些供日常运维管理使用的预置剧本:

  • 数据库下线pgsql-rm.yml 可以移除现有的数据库集群或实例,回收节点。
  • 创建业务数据库pgsql-createdb.yml 可以在现有集群中创建新的数据库或修改现有数据库。
  • 创建业务用户pgsql-createuser.yml 可以在现有集群中创建新用户或修改现有用户。

基础设施初始化

如何使用剧本初始化基础设施

拉起数据库集群

如何定义并拉起PostgreSQL数据库集群

沙箱初始化

如何使用快速部署沙箱环境

最后修改 2021-03-01: update doc (2acec6d)